A CASE REPORT OF ANTERIOR OPEN-BITE (전치부 Open-bite의 치험일례)

  • We have effectually treated 22 years girl who had complained of an aterior open-bite. Treatment was based on non-extracted and multibanded technigue at the use of horizontal loop with 0.016 inch green Elgiloy wire. Anteior cross elastics, C1Ⅲ intermaxillary elastics, occasicnally C1.Ⅱ elastics were used. when vertical discrepancy was corrected, we changed the arch wire making use of 0.018 ×0.022 inch rectangular wire with 1st. and 2nd. order bend. After 12mons. the ideal arch wire with tie back loop was placed for stabilizing arch. Nearly after 20 months bands were removed and placed retainer.

A CLINICAL CONSIDERATION ON THE EFFECT OF FR III IN GROWING PATIENTS WITH ANTERIOR CROSS-BITE (성장기 반대교합자의 FR III 효과에 관한 임상적 고찰)

  • The purpose of this study was to assess the early effect of FR III on the growing patients with anterior cross-bite. The lateral cephalograms and models were obtained from 7 patients at the time of pretreatment and correction of anterior cross-bite. The results were as follows: 1. A slight tendency of rotation toward anterosuperior direction and the growth to anterior direction were shown in maxilla. 2. There were a little change of mandibular vertical position and increase in lower facial height although some variations existed. 3. The bodily or labial tipping movement was shown in maxillary incisors. 4. The lingual tipping of mandibular incisors was shown in all cases. 5. Maxillary arch width increased while mandibular arch width usually changed a little although some variations existed. But it was difficult to summary in a word because variable responses were noted according to a wide variety of skeletal type, growth, and malocclusion.

Change of the upper airway after mandibular setback surgery in patients with mandibular prognathism and anterior open bite

  • Purpose: It has been reported before that the amount of pharyngeal airway space (PAS) significantly decreases following mandibular setback (MS) surgery in patients with mandibular prognathism (MP). Further, MP patients with an anterior open-bite (AOB) presentation may show a larger decrease in PAS compared with those without AOB. However, studies on postoperative PAS changes in MP patients with AOB remain rare. This study sought to evaluate changes in PAS and hyoid bone positioning following MS surgery in MP patients with and without AOB. Patients and methods: Twenty patients who underwent two jaw surgery involving MS movement were included. Patients were divided into a non-AOB group (n = 10; overbite > 2 mm) and an AOB group (n = 10; overbite < - 4 mm). Three-dimensional changes in PAS and hyoid bone positioning were compared and statistically evaluated pre- and postoperatively using computed tomography (CT). Results: The mean magnitude of MS was 6.0 ± 2.8 mm and 5.6 ± 3.2 mm in the non-AOB group and AOB group, respectively. The oropharyngeal volume and upper hypopharyngeal volume were significantly reduced after surgery in both the groups (p = 0.006 and p = 0.003), while the retroglossal cross-sectional area was significantly reduced only in the AOB group (p = 0.028). Although the AOB group showed a larger decrease in PAS, the difference was not statistically significant between the groups. The position of the hyoid bone showed significant posterior and inferior displacement only in the AOB group, while the vertical displacement of the hyoid bone showed a statistically significant difference between the two groups. Conclusion: PAS was significantly decreased after MS in both the groups, while only the AOB group presented a statistically significant reduction in the retroglossal cross-sectional area. Vertical displacement of the hyoid bone showed a statistically significant difference between the groups, while the PAS change was not. Surgeons should be aware of potential postoperative airway problems that may arise when performing MS surgeries.

A CLINICAL CONSIDERATION ON TREATMENT OF ANTERIOR CROSS-BITE IN GROWING CHILDREN (THE EFFECT OF CHIN CAP) (성장기아동(成長期兒童)의 반대교합치료(反對咬合治療)에 관(關)한 임상적(臨床的) 고찰(考察) (- 신모효과(?帽?果) -))

  • The author evaluated the effect of chin cap for the growing patient with cross-bite. The date were obtained from superimposition of pre and post-treatment lateral cephalograms. The results might be as follows; 1. increase ANB angle, Y-axis angle, SN-MP angle. 2. made anterior facial height more greater than posterior facial height. 3. as a results, rotate mandible backward.

A CASE REPORT OF ANGLE'S CLASS III MALOCCLUSION WITH ASYMMETRIC MANDIBULAR PROGNATHISM (비대칭성 하악골 전돌증을 동반한 Angle씨 III급 부정교합의 치험 예)

  • 20 years old female patient with asymmetric mandibular prognathism had anterior openbite, anterior cross-bite and mandibular shift. This patient was treated with both orthodontic and surgical method. Maxillary second molars were extracted to reduce the wedging effect and maxillary first molars moved to distal by straight pull head gear. After orthognathic surgery, open-bite was corrected with multiple shoe-loop arch wire.

PATTERNS OF OCCLUSION IN THE PRIMARY DENTITION (유치열 교합양상에 관한 고찰(일차보고))

  • The author studied clinically the state of sagittal molar relationship, sagittal canine relationship and frontal molar relationship in 3 years old, 1624 children. The results were as followings; 1. In frontal molar relationship, 1369 children(86.0%) showed normal transversal relation, 214(13.2%) showed cross bite and 14(0.8%) showed scissors bite. 2. In sagittal molar relationship, 41 children(4.4%) showed vertical terminal plane, 352(21.7%) showed distal step, 807(49.7%) showed mesial step and 394(24.2%) showed unilaterally. 3. In sagittal canine relationship, 186 children(11.5%) showed same plane, 248(15.3%) showed distal step, 777(47.8%) showed mesial step and 413 (25.4%) showed unilaterally.

Use of digital scan data for evaluation of edentulous ridge relationship: A case report for removable prosthesis with unilateral cross bite (디지털 스캔 데이터를 활용한 무치악 치조제 관계의 평가와 인공치 선택: 편측 교차교합의 가철성 의치 수복 증례)

  • After the teeth were extracted, maxillary and mandibular alveolar ridges show the opposite resorption pattern and as a result, the mandibular arch is enlarged than maxillary arch relatively. In this situation, we should evaluate both alveolar ridge relationship and arrange the artificial teeth properly for stability of removable prosthesis. This case is a 77 years old male patient who wishes to make removable prosthesis and has atrophic alveolar ridge. By use of model scanner and CAD software, the angle between interalveolar crest line and occlusal plane was easily measured. Depending on the measurement, the artificial teeth are arranged in unilateral cross bite and after completion, patient was satisfied with the denture which showed proper stability, retention, support.

A STUDY ON THE IRREGULARITIES OF TEETH IN MALOCCLUSION (부정교합(不正咬合)의 치아부정양상(齒牙不正樣相)에 관(關)한 연구(硏究))

  • The purpose of this study was to investigate the pattern of irregularities of teeth in various malocclusion groups. The subjects consist of 803 out-patients (355 males, and 448 females) in department of Orthodontics of S.N.U. Hospital, Yonsei University, and Kyunghi University Hospital. The results were as follows. 1. The proportions of subjects on the basis of Angle's Classification were 39.2% (42.2% male, and 57.8% fomale) in class I malocclusion, 29.0% (44.6% male, and 55.4% female) in class II. div. 1., 3.5%(46.4% male, and 53.6% female) in class II. div. 2., 28.3%(46.3% male, and 53.7% female) in class III. 2. Considering all the subjects, the percentage of teeth crowding was 67.8% (45.0% male, and 55.0% female). In class I malocclusion, the percentage of Crowding was 70.8%(43.5% male, and 56.5% female) with higher frequency in upper anterior teeth than in lower anterior. 3. The percentage of Maxillary anterior diastema was 25.6% (45.6% male, and 54.4% female) on the whole. In class II. div. 1. malocclusion, the percentage was 28.8% (46.3% male, and 53.7% female) and in class III, the percentage was 19.8% (46.7% male, and 53.3% female). Thus, frequency of maxillary anterior distema, was comparatively higher in class II. div. 1. than in class III. 4. The percentage of high canine was 25.1% (53.2% male, and 46.8% female) on the whole, and was 86.0% male and 76.6% female in right side, 73.0% male and 72.3% female in left side. In calss II. div. 2., the percentage was 53.6% (46.7% male, and 53.3% female ). In class II. div. 1., the percentage was 16.7% (46.2% male, and 53.8%) with higher frequency in class II. div.2. 5. The percentage of deep overbite was 23.0% (43. 2% male, and 56.8% female) on the whole. Ia class 11. div. 2., and in clas sll. div. 1., its were 89.3%(48.0% male and 52.0% female), 54.5% (40.9% male, and 59.1% female) respectively. This result can be considered as one of the characterics of Angle's class 11 malocclusion group. 6. The percentage of spacing was 23.0% (36.8% male, and 63.2% female) on the whole, In class II. div. 1., and in class II. div. 2., its were 26.1% (44.3% male, and 55. 7% female), 7.1% (50.0% male, and 50.0% female) respectively. 7. The percentage of open bite was 14.3% (42.6% male, and 57.4% female) on the whole with higher rate on the anterior part. It rated 17.6%(50. 0% male, and 50.0% female) in class III, but none in class II. div. 2. 8. The percentage of crossbite was 22.5% (55.8% male, and 44.2% female) on the whole, with higher frequency on the anterior part than on the posterior part. In Angle's class III, it rated as much as 55.1% (57.6% male, and 42.4% female). 9. The percentage of edge-to-edge bite was 20.4% (47.6% male, and 52.4% female) with higher frequency on anterior part than on posterior part. 10. The percentage of irregularities of teeth in various malocclusion groups, was 21.5% (24.8% maxillary, and 18.1% mandible) in crowding, 20.8% (23.5% maxillary, and 18.0% mandible) in rotation, 10.7% (10.6% maxillary, and 10.8% mandible) in cross bite, 9.5% (11.8% maxillary, and 7.3% mandible) in spacing, 8.5% (8.5% maxillary, and 8.5% mandible) in edge-to-edge bite, 8.1% (8.3% maxillary, 7.8% mandible) in open bite. Crowding teeth, spacing teeth, and rotating teeh were more prevalent in anterior part than in posterior part. Cross bite teeth and edge-to-edge bite teeth were more prevalent in class III malocclusion than in another.
